Output 7d0403926fa95b18b71e807ea23ad261378cf9a652ed5f14c47c5fd3eec3b731:1

value
676460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b71143c5c1560aa7587c52ea14808e5a7bb17b05 OP_EQUAL
address
3JNzGDvXgzkYXXdeGbs6N8RGz4pSQmYRi2
transaction
7d0403926fa95b18b71e807ea23ad261378cf9a652ed5f14c47c5fd3eec3b731
confirmations
150906
spent
true